Cottingham train station provides essential services to ensure a smooth travel experience. Although there is no ticket office, ticket machines are available, making it straightforward to collect pre-purchased tickets. It’s important to note that there are no accessible ticket machines or smartcard validators, however, smartcards can be issued here. The station is equipped with an induction loop, ideal for those with hearing impairments.
For those requiring assistance, be aware that no staff help is available on-site. However, there are help points around the station to facilitate communication for further support. The friendly conductors can assist passengers with boarding and disembarking, and Passenger Assist services are accessible for booking in advance.
Cottingham station strives to accommodate all mobility needs. With step-free access to Platform 2 (Scarborough direction), it is partially accessible. Note that a steeped footbridge accesses Platform 1, making entry challenging for some individuals. A ramp is available for train access, and mobility scooters are welcome in certain areas. While there are no accessible toilets or waiting rooms, there are well-positioned seating areas for a more comfortable wait.
Should your journey extend beyond Cottingham, several transport links are conveniently available. A closeby bus stop allows passengers to easily transfer between rail and bus services using Busline at 0871 200 2233 for information. A rail replacement service is also provided in the event of train disruptions, picking up in the station's car park. While there is no bicycle hire at the station, ample space caters to cyclists with 6 bike stands near the car park.
If you need a quick transfer, taxis can be easily booked through Northern Railway’s cab4you service. It’s worth noting that car parking facilities are available 24 hours a day, free of charge, with a limited number of spaces.

London Bridge Station is equipped with a wide array of facilities aimed at enhancing the traveler experience. Ticketing services are comprehensive, with a ticket office open from the early hours of 04:45 until 01:00 the following morning on weekdays and Saturdays, and from 05:25 on Sundays. Travelers can also find numerous ticket machines throughout the station, making ticket purchase quick and convenient.
For those who might need assistance, there is a strong support system in place. Staff is available to help each day from 04:00 to 01:00, and customer help points are strategically placed for easy access. Moreover, the station is designed to be fully accessible, featuring step-free access across all platforms via lifts, ensuring a seamless experience for all passengers.
Whether you’re feeling peckish or need a quick caffeine fix, the station's concourse boasts a variety of food and drink options. From cozy cafes with seating to bustling food kiosks, there are plenty of choices to suit every palate. ATMs are conveniently located on both the lower and upper concourses, allowing you to manage your travel finances with ease.
This hub isn't just limited to train journeys. The station connects to multiple modes of transport, enhancing its role as a travel nexus. Buses are readily accessible from the station’s main entrance and also from Tooley Street. There is a taxi rank situated right outside the main doors, providing quick rides to your next destination.
For those who prefer cycling, while there isn’t an official hire service within the station, nearby Duke Street Hill provides convenient bicycle rentals. Additionally, London Bridge Station extends its reach to airports, with direct train connections to Gatwick and Luton Airports, appealing to international travelers.
